Perceptions of prescription warning labels within an ... Prescription warning labels are small colored stickers placed adjacent to the drug label on a prescription bottle that provides important cautionary information concerning the safe administration of a medicine. For example, "take with food" or "limit time in sunlight when taking this medication". Intelligence For Your Life - Drug Warning Labels and What ... Drug warning label #1: Take with food or milk. What that means is that the medicine can upset your stomach, but you’ll be fine if you coat your stomach first with a little fat and protein. What about take on an empty stomach? That means eating could prevent the drug from being absorbed properly. Avoid vitamins, too!

A Warning About Warning Labels - U.S. Pharmacist Feb 20, 2009 · Label Color: Approximately 42% of the patients correlated the label’s color to the severity of the message. Patients reported that a red label meant danger, yellow translated to caution, and blue, white, and green labels were viewed as “recommendations” that were not as critical as the instructions on red labels.
